The Challenge – High demand for data transmission on trains
The increasing electronics content requirements of modern mass transit systems, i.e. engine diagnostics, brake controls, environmental
conditioning, passenger display systems, networking, lighting control, etc., coupled with increasing data grouping and through-put
requirements continue to mandate innovative solutions in our interconnect products. Consequently, our mass-transit customers approached
ITT ICS requesting solutions to establish reliable connections between coaches, acknowledging the menagerie of data this needs. In particu-
lar, these customers requested a solution for data transmission which bundled multiple Ethernet and MVB lines into a singular connector.

The ITT Solution
Listening to our customer requests, ITT ICS met the challenge by developing our new QXM12 contacts mounted into
FRCIR connector series hardware. With this pioneering design, four conductor wires and the associated braid from
shielded cables are integrated into the QXM12 contact. A special plastic insert groups multiple QXM12 contacts and their
cables into a singular connector. With this connector, our customers may now locate data transfer from Ethernet, MVB,
WTB, and Video lines, according to VG95234, within the same connector.

Technical Overview
The CIR-M12 DATABUS is a special circular Bayonet Lock Connector for Data Line transmission. This innovative,
new connector incorporates the ITT ICS QXM12 contact arrangement to provide data transfer from Ethernet,
MVB, WTB, and Video lines, according to VG95234 where applicable, within a singular connector.

Derived from the ICS Cannon Quadrax contact, the QXM12 represents an innovative adaptation of this proven
arrangement for the needs of our mass-transit customers. The QXM12 contact system provides specific function-
ality for data transfer from Ethernet, MVB, WTB, and Video lines.
